Miller County Quorum Court OKs spending on juvenile detention and transportation

TEXARKANA, Ark. -- Juvenile detention and transportation both received financing during a Miller County Quorum Court meeting Monday.

During the meeting, which took place at the county's Extension Office at 1007 Jefferson Ave., justices agreed to spend $100,000 on juvenile offender transportation, as well as $250,000 on detention meals and lodging.

Since the County closed its Juvenile Detention Center last year, county officials have been sending juveniles to the JDC in Pine Bluff, Arkansas.
